초록(영문) | Turbo-down-sizing is one of methods to improve fuel economy and engine performance. But, it causes higher torquefluctuation and vibration in engines. So, it is necessary to increase rotational moment of inertia of flywheel to make torquefluctuation and vibration small, but it means mass increase and decrease fuel economy. So, in this study, by adding some masto flywheel at local points, it was studied to reduce toque variation under low rotational moment inertia and mass. |
